Albion are “quite relaxed” about Lewis Dunk’s future at the club, according to Graham Potter.

And his transfer window message has been echoed by Dunk’s sidekick and close mate Shane Duffy.

Dunk has been linked with interest from Chelsea, although The Argus understands there has been no inquiry from Stamford Bridge.

The Seagulls skipper is under contract until the summer of 2023.

Head coach Potter said: “He’s signed a long term contract and we’re quite relaxed about the situation.

“I’ve really enjoyed working with Lewis as a footballer and as a person. He’s really important for us and we’re really happy that he’s with us.”

Duffy added: “Since the day I have walked in, he has been linked nearly every window but he never changes, if you speak to him.

“He loves this place and I think he is thriving under the new manager.

“His performances this year have been better than every year so far.

“If he keeps going, you never know, but I know he is happy here so hopefully we can keep him.”
